Episode 3538 was broadcast on 19 August 2003, as part of Series 50.
Nick Smith played Brian McKeon, with Brian McKeon winning 83 – 58. The Dictionary Corner guest was Richard Stilgoe, and the lexicographer was Susie Dent.
